Insurance Counselor II – ROPS

DaVita Kidney Care

• Provides education and guidance to DaVita patients about health insurance and the implications of different insurance options • Conducts 100% telephonic patient insurance education while operating within established compliance parameters of the company • Identifies and effectively communicates opportunities to better the insurance status of the patient to help reduce or alleviate financial risk and burden • Provides information to patients to help them find and/or secure options for insurance coverage and other financial assistance programs as necessary • Provides a high level of customer service to patients across multiple DaVita Dialysis facilities to ensure educational needs are met and to ensure patient questions or issues are addressed effectively • Completes insurance assessments/evaluations for patients to accurately document patient education sessions • Acts as a liaison between patients, facility teammates, billing office, and the corporate office to resolve patient insurance issues and/or concerns • Builds and maintains relationships with field partners (e.g. Home Program Departments, Facility Administrators, Social Workers, Administrative Assistants, etc.) to ensure seamless patient support • Works closely with supervisor/manager to meet objectives, deadlines, and reporting/measurement requirements as they pertain to patient education • Provides monthly reporting and analysis on key metrics related to patient education and advocacy as well as actively participates in monthly operations reviews on assigned patient portfolio • Seeks to find opportunities for continuous process improvement and reviews ideas with the team and operational leadership • Attends team meetings, phone conferences, and training as needed; may assist with onboarding and training of new teammates or other duties as assigned

Job Requirements

  • High School Diploma or equivalent required
  • Minimum of one (1) year experience working with Medicare and Medicaid insurance, as well as commercial insurance plans and benefits (PPO, HMO, POS, EPO, Indemnity), strongly preferred
  • Minimum of one (1) year experience in a healthcare organization working with clinical staff and patients preferred
  • Intermediate computer skills and proficiency in MS Word, Excel, PowerPoint, and Outlook required
  • PowerPoint preferred
  • Bilingual/Spanish Speaking required
